Abstract
Generating well-developed laser speckle in the laboratory is an important first step in studying its effects on adaptive optics or tracking performance. As such, we discuss the measurement techniques used to measure the statistical distribution of laser speckle generated from a holographic diffuser, as well as the speckle contrast.
